Secret Life Underground
Secret Life Underground

Secret Life Underground

The underground world is a largely unexplored universe. Find out what goes on in the subterranean world of our planet Earth.

Where to Watch

Stream, buy or rent this tv show from the providers below.

Stream
Curiosity Stream
Curiosity Stream
CuriosityStream Apple TV Channel
CuriosityStream Apple TV Channel
Buy
Not available
Rent
Not available